**Handover note — Simmerwell scaling engine, from Priya's old desk to Dario**

Quick brain-dump for whoever maintains the plugin surface next. External authors hook into the unit-conversion stage, so don't change the rounding mode without a deprecation cycle — last time we did, three plugins started producing quarter-egg measurements and people were, understandably, annoyed. Ratios are cached per recipe, so plugins should never mutate them in place. The current engine settings that plugins run against are these.

service settings:
druael:
  log_level: error
  metrics_host: metrics.druael.tolvaqlabs.internal
  pool_size: 16

### Relevance tuning notes

Plugins extending the Marrowfield search pipeline should treat scoring weights as contractual: the ranker combines lexical, freshness, and engagement signals, and any custom stage runs after normalization. Changing a single weight shifts the others proportionally, so test against the shared relevance suite before proposing adjustments. Weights below were validated against the Bramlett corpus in the latest evaluation round and should be considered the baseline for all extensions.

limits module of fajog-tawig:
RATE_LIMITS = {
    "druwyn": 2,
    "quenael": 10,
    "wenix": 2,
    "druael": 2,
}

QUARTERLY PLANNING NOTE — Heads of Department

Subject: Reseller programme, next quarter

The Lanthorn reseller programme expands from six to eleven partners next quarter. Tier criteria are unchanged; margin bands tighten by one point at the entry tier. Onboarding moves to a four-week cycle managed by Demelza's team. Support load is expected to rise roughly 15%; staffing is budgeted. Partner conflicts with direct accounts go through the existing escalation path. The confidential note below sets out the strategic intent behind the expansion.

board note of kagep-yahig: Only 9 of the 120 pilot accounts renewed Quenix, so a churn review is set for April 1.